解决Chrome浏览器跨域

前后端分离以后经常会遇到的一个跨域问题No 'Access-Control-Allow-Origin'。不想要后台小哥哥修改跨域策略。但自己又必须在Chrome上面调试页面。那么下面这个方法值得一试。
解决方案引用自
Disable same origin policy in Chrome
Google Chrome忽略https证书错误
这边摘要Win10环境的解决方案。
1.Win+R召唤出运行界面。

image.png

2.输入以下命令,就会出现一个新的浏览器窗口。会提示你浏览器安全度降低,表示成功了。现在可以试试需要调试的界面。理论来说是不会提示跨域问题。注意chrome.exe是你安装Chrome浏览器的位置
chrome.exe --user-data-dir="C://Chrome dev session" --disable-web-security

image.png

有的API可能会对IP进行https加密或者自签证书,此时使用浏览器调试会报证书错误的问题。类似ERR_CERT_COMMON_NAME_INVALID
此时只需要在上述命令后面再加上
--test-type --ignore-certificate-errors
完整的命令如下:
chrome.exe --user-data-dir="C://Chrome dev session" --disable-web-security --test-type --ignore-certificate-errors

©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 今天感恩节哎,感谢一直在我身边的亲朋好友。感恩相遇!感恩不离不弃。 中午开了第一次的党会,身份的转变要...
    迷月闪星情阅读 10,627评论 0 11
  • 彩排完,天已黑
    刘凯书法阅读 4,347评论 1 3
  • 表情是什么,我认为表情就是表现出来的情绪。表情可以传达很多信息。高兴了当然就笑了,难过就哭了。两者是相互影响密不可...
    Persistenc_6aea阅读 126,617评论 2 7